New to gaming by Important_Zone_711 in PS5HelpSupport

[–]ALilFatigued 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Open it up and make sure the battery is plugged in, I know that sounds insane but just do it. A small Philips head screwdriver, 30 minutes and a YouTube video will get you in and to where you need to be. Plus then if your controller ever goes haywire, ie. stick drift, button sticking etc. then you know how to get in and take a look at things.

Car is bogging when under heavy acceleration. by ALilFatigued in E34

[–]ALilFatigued[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I cleaned all the aluminum tubes while I was under there, the one running to the oil separator as well as the two coolant pipes (that’s why I was there to begin with, damn 30 year old o rings were dust and as such were pouring coolant) as well as replaced and lubed all the o rings for the coolant pipe and that oil separator pipe. Note this problem was occurring before all of this work so I don’t believe it is my doing however it has gotten worse over time so I’m trying to fix it ASAP. Injectors have all new o rings and lubed them all before reinstallation. They should all be properly seated and I put all the retainer clips back. Air filter is aftermarket Spectre that I have cleaned but it could use another I suppose (I know I know, “cold air intake no hp”, it came with the intake when I purchased the vehicle and he didn’t have the original) Fuel regulator is a good idea so I’ll pull that off to check its functionality and there is an occasional fuel smell after I park but nothing visibly wet or leaking. I also didn’t remove the throttle body when I took out the manifold so I’ll see about that gasket. Thanks for the suggestions!
